Florida’s signature dessert made with tart key lime filling in a crumb crust, often topped with whipped cream. It is a classic sweet treat across Orlando and Central Florida.
A seasonal Florida seafood specialty, usually served chilled with mustard sauce. It is prized for sweet, firm claw meat and is strongly associated with the state’s coastal food culture.
Fried alligator pieces, usually lightly breaded and served with dipping sauce. This is a distinctly Floridian dish that appears on many casual local menus.

Moderate overall. Theme parks and resort areas are pricey, but chain restaurants and casual dining offer better value.
Tip 18-20% at restaurants; 20%+ for great service. Tip bartenders USD 1-2 per drink, taxi/rideshare 10-15%, hotel staff USD 2-5, and round up for cafes if desired.
